Lines Matching refs:EglExtensions

86 } EglExtensions;  variable
127 if (Properties::useBufferAge && EglExtensions.bufferAge) { in initialize()
144 hasWideColorSpaceExtension = EglExtensions.displayP3; in initialize()
146 hasWideColorSpaceExtension = EglExtensions.scRGB; in initialize()
150 mHasWideColorGamutSupport = EglExtensions.glColorSpace && hasWideColorSpaceExtension; in initialize()
301 EglExtensions.bufferAge = in initExtensions()
303 EglExtensions.setDamage = extensions.has("EGL_KHR_partial_update"); in initExtensions()
307 EglExtensions.glColorSpace = extensions.has("EGL_KHR_gl_colorspace"); in initExtensions()
308 EglExtensions.noConfigContext = extensions.has("EGL_KHR_no_config_context"); in initExtensions()
309 EglExtensions.pixelFormatFloat = extensions.has("EGL_EXT_pixel_format_float"); in initExtensions()
310 EglExtensions.scRGB = extensions.has("EGL_EXT_gl_colorspace_scrgb"); in initExtensions()
311 EglExtensions.displayP3 = extensions.has("EGL_EXT_gl_colorspace_display_p3_passthrough"); in initExtensions()
312 EglExtensions.hdr = extensions.has("EGL_EXT_gl_colorspace_bt2020_pq"); in initExtensions()
313 EglExtensions.contextPriority = extensions.has("EGL_IMG_context_priority"); in initExtensions()
314 EglExtensions.surfacelessContext = extensions.has("EGL_KHR_surfaceless_context"); in initExtensions()
315 EglExtensions.fenceSync = extensions.has("EGL_KHR_fence_sync"); in initExtensions()
316 EglExtensions.waitSync = extensions.has("EGL_KHR_wait_sync"); in initExtensions()
317 EglExtensions.nativeFenceSync = extensions.has("EGL_ANDROID_native_fence_sync"); in initExtensions()
342 if (EglExtensions.pixelFormatFloat) { in loadConfigs()
347 EglExtensions.pixelFormatFloat = false; in loadConfigs()
362 if (Properties::contextPriority != 0 && EglExtensions.contextPriority) { in createContext()
368 mEglDisplay, EglExtensions.noConfigContext ? ((EGLConfig) nullptr) : mEglConfig, in createContext()
378 if (mPBufferSurface == EGL_NO_SURFACE && !EglExtensions.surfacelessContext) { in createPBufferSurface()
393 if (!EglExtensions.noConfigContext) { in createSurface()
448 if (EglExtensions.glColorSpace) { in createSurface()
587 if (EglExtensions.setDamage && mSwapBehavior == SwapBehavior::BufferAge) { in damageFrame()
599 return EglExtensions.setDamage && mSwapBehavior == SwapBehavior::BufferAge; in damageRequiresSwap()
676 if (EglExtensions.waitSync && EglExtensions.nativeFenceSync) { in fenceWait()
720 if (EglExtensions.nativeFenceSync) { in createReleaseFence()
737 } else if (useFenceSync && EglExtensions.fenceSync) { in createReleaseFence()